Art – Kunakorn Yaemnam
Student President, Faculty of Law, Sripatum University, Academic Year 2019
Q: Why do you want to be student president ?
A: In high school, I enjoyed doing activities a lot and always participated in school activities. However, when I entered university, the pressure and expectations of my parents for my studies began to increase, so I felt that my life was missing something. Therefore, I decided to run for president because I believed that the happiness that I had lost would return and increase from doing activities.
Q: What do you think the president has to be responsible for ?
A: The title “Chairman” comes with a lot of responsibility. The responsibilities include studying, activities, taking care of juniors, welcoming new students, and being a representative of the faculty in various matters.
Q: What are your strengths and weaknesses ?
A: As for what I consider to be my strengths, they are my leadership skills and management experience that I gained from participating in activities in high school. However, everyone has weaknesses. My weakness is that I am too empathetic towards others, which can sometimes cause problems at work.
Q: What are the challenges of being student president ?
A: The most challenging thing would be team management because it requires many management skills. But for the Faculty of Law Student Committee team, I believe it is not difficult because we all have the same goal: to do everything for the faculty.
Q: What do you think is the most important thing about work?
A: A good team. The outcome of the work depends on the team’s work. A good team must have unity. If we are united, I believe that every job will be successful and go smoothly.
